Compatibility
Our designers have sized the engine to operate on any traditional 0-27 or larger O Gauge track system, including RealTrax® using any standard AC transformer including the Z-500 transformer packaged in
your set. (See page 19 for a complete list of compatible transformers as well as wiring instructions.) All RailKing® products are compatible with most other 3-rail locomotives, rolling stock, and accessories.
Equipment Options
Your ready-to-run set features a 0-4-0 steam locomotive equipped with an operating headlight, mechanical whistle, ProtoSmoke® operating
smoke unit and a solid state electronic reverse unit. All are simple and fun to operate. In addition to the locomotive, your set should also
include a circle of RealTrax® track (8 curved sections), a RealTrax® lighted lock-on and wire harness set (for connecting the track to the transformer) and a 50-watt Z-500 transformer and controller.

Adding Smoke Fluid
The 0-4-0 contains a self-powered smoke unit that outputs a steady stream of smoke through the smoke stack on the top of the engine. The ON/OFF switch must be in the ON position in order for the smoke unit to function. See Fig. 10 below.
The smoke unit is essentially a small heating element and wick which soak up and then “cook" a mineral oil-based fluid, that creates a
harmless smoke. The smoke is then forced out of the stack via a small electric fan which runs at a constant speed. However, the smoke
intensity can be varied by changing the transformer voltage setting. The higher the setting, the more intense the smoke output
Before operating the engine, you should add smoke fluid to the smoke unit by pouring 15 - 25 drops of fluid into the locomotive’s smoke
stack. Use the included ProtoSmoke® smoke fluid vial or Seuthe, LGB or LVTS smoke fluid before you run the engine. If you don’t choose to
add the fluid, then the smoke unit switch should be turned off. Failure to either add the fluid or turn the switch off could lead to damage to the smoke unit heating element and or wicking. After
adding the fluid, gently blow into the stack to eliminate any air bubbles. Do not overfill the unit as overfilling can cause the fluid to leak out and coat the interior engine components. When the smoke output begins to
diminish while running the engine, an additional 20--25
drops of smoke fluid should be added or the smoke unit switch should be turned off.

Electronic Reverse Unit
The 0-4-0 model is controlled by an electronic reverse unit. The reverse unit operates in the same manner that all reverse units function by using forward, neutral and reverse states that are entered each time the throttle is turned on and off, or by using the transformer direction
button (if so equipped).
In addition to the electronic reverse unit, your new train set locomotive features a mechanical whistle that can be activated by pressing the
white Horn/Whistle button on your Z-500 transformer. Any compatible transformer horn/whistle button will also activate the whistle in your
new locomotive. Simply pressing the Horn/Whistle button whenever the throttle is above the OFF setting should activate the whistle. If the
whistle doesn’t blow, increase the throttle setting and press the button again. The whistle will blow as long as the button is depressed and voltage is applied to the track.

Starting to Roll
Advance the transformer throttle. The locomotive's light will come on and the engine should now proceed in the forward direction. At this
point, advancing the throttle further will allow the engine to pick up speed, reducing the throttle will slow the engine down. Turning the throttle OFF and then back ON will park the engine into neutral. Cycling the throttle OFF and then back ON again one more time will allow the locomotive to enter reverse.
Tip: An alternative method to using the throttle to enter the next reverse unit state is to press the direction button. When depressed, the transformer interrupts all power to the track. Releasing the button reapplies power to the track at whatever voltage level the transformer throttle is set at.

Special Reverse Unit Options
Locking Out The Reverse Unit Into A Single Direction
Your locomotive’s electronic reverse unit may be locked out into one of three positions; forward,
neutral or reverse. Locking the engine into one of
these three positions prevents the locomotive from cycling through the
reverse unit phases and is useful for operators employing block signal operations on their layout. Once locked into a position, turning the throttle OFF and then ON again will not allow the engine to enter the next reverse unit phase and instead keeps the engine in the current locked direction.
To lock the engine into one of the three positions, simply enter that position using the transformer throttle or direction button. Once in the
desired direction, remove the locomotive from the track and slide the ON/OFF switch located on the bottom of the tender (See Figure 13) to the OFF position. This locks the engine into the desired direction.
Sliding the switch back to the ON position resets the reverse unit into its normal cycling phases.

Grease
Grease should be added to the internal drive gears annually or after every 50 hours of operation. Grease can be added by inserting grease into the gear box inside the locomotive chassis. In order to access the gear box, the boiler must be removed from the chassis by unscrewing the four chassis screws as seen in Figure 15 below. Once the boiler is removed, the smoke unit and the light bracket must also be removed,
then the gear box can be opened up by unscrewing the three screws on the plate located in front of the motor. Grease can then be applied
into the gear box using a grease tube dispenser.

Locomotive Smoke Unit Maintenance
Operating the engine without smoke fluid and with the smoke unit switch in the ON position can damage your smoke unit wick, causing the wick to become hard, blackened and unabsorbent around the heating element. When this occurs, it may be difficult for the wick to soak up the smoke fluid resulting in poor or no smoke output. If that occurs, we recommend that you inspect and/or replace the wick taking
care to not run the smoke unit without fluid in the future. You can inspect the wick to see if it needs replacement by removing the smoke
unit inspection cover from the body as seen in Fig. 21. After removing the chassis and inspection cover screws lift the inspection plate away and inspect the wick. If the wick is darkly discolored and hard, it should be replaced. Replacement wick and detailed instructions
are available directly from MTH Electric Trains.
